The Curious Paradise ‘double whammy’: This release contains an audio CD plus a bonus DVD of part of the concert! As you will see from the track listing below, the selections are pretty much as the studio album. So why put out such a similar programme? Well, as you’ll see from the blurb in ‘About Curious Paradise’ the production of this album was really something of a surprise. We were touring to promote the first album and serendipitously we ended up with a live version that was too good to leave on the shelf. In any event, the addition of Steve Hamilton and Steve Watts lifted the band a gear and inevitably influenced the whole colour of sound we were creating. This, coupled with the fact that the band had now some serious touring experience under its collective belt, meant that the pieces had a new energy which merited being documented.

There are plans for a full-length DVD in the near future which will include additional narrative footage. For now, this vignette contains half an hour of the concert. The audio quality is notable for its ‘studio-like’ clarity and warmth, without having lost any of that vital ‘live’ presence. A treat for hi-fi buffs!

Personel:
Pete Oxley electric, acoustic, synth guitars
Mark Lockheart tenor, soprano saxophones; bass clarinet
Steve Hamilton piano; keyboards
Steve Watts acoustic, electric basses; percussion
Russ Morgan drums; percussion

Audio CD recorded live at the Zodiac Club, Oxford, 20th May ‘04; mixed at ‘The Better Button’ by Adrian Zolotuhin in January ‘05. DVD filmed by Robin Hill at The Zodiac Club, Oxford 20th May ‘04.
